The rumor mill has been very active of late and one of the biggest talking points has centered around a sensational trade deal between the Los Angeles Lakers and the Houston Rockets involving Russell Westbrook and John Wall. According to reports, the Rockets have shown interest in potentially trading for the embattled Russell Westbrook as the Lakers look to move on from what has turned out to be a botched experiment.

Wall himself has just added more fuel to the fire with his recent social media activity. For some reason, the Rockets guard just liked a tweet wherein renowned NBA insider Skip Bayless talks about the benefits of a Westbrook-for-Wall trade for LA:

Bayless points out that for the Lakers, the primary objective should be to get rid of Russell Westbrook — at all costs. There reportedly has been zero interest in the market for the former MVP with his gargantuan contract being the most significant stumbling block in any potential deal. That is, of course, before Houston came into the picture.

The Rockets have themselves been trying to move on from John Wall, but their efforts have been unsuccessful thus far. He too has a massive deal that has turned off any interest from opposing teams. It's pretty much the same situation the Lakers have with Russ, so I guess it only makes sense that these two teams consider swapping players. To some extent, this would be a win-win deal for both sides as they both get a fresh start in a potential trade.
